The Significance of Volunteering in Community Development
Volunteering plays a crucial role in community development by addressing various social needs and fostering a sense of collective responsibility. When individuals dedicate their time and skills to volunteer work, they contribute to projects and initiatives that improve local living conditions and support vulnerable populations.
Volunteers often provide essential services, such as helping at food banks, organizing educational programs, or participating in environmental conservation efforts. These contributions can bridge gaps in community services and create positive social change. Moreover, volunteering helps build stronger community bonds by bringing people together to work toward common goals.
Additionally, volunteering offers personal benefits to the individuals involved. It can enhance skills, provide valuable work experience, and offer a sense of purpose and fulfillment. Engaging in volunteer activities also promotes empathy and understanding, as individuals interact with diverse groups and learn about different perspectives and challenges.
In essence, volunteering is a powerful tool for community development. It not only addresses immediate needs but also cultivates a culture of collaboration and support, ultimately leading to more resilient and vibrant communities.
